<h1>SEBI extends deadline for mutual funds to submit offsite inspection data from 10 to 15 days post-quarter.</h1> The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) has extended the deadline for mutual funds to submit offsite inspection data. Previously, mutual funds were required to submit daily data in a monthly file on a quarterly basis within 10 calendar days after the quarter's end. This has now been extended to 15 calendar days. Registrars to an Issue and Share Transfer Agents (RTAs) are required to submit this data on an ongoing basis. This change aims to facilitate ease of business and is effective immediately, issued under the authority of the SEBI Act and Mutual Funds Regulations.
